7

Twitter 認証に tweepy を使用しようとすると、次のエラーが表示されます。

  File "/usr/local/lib/python2.7/dist-packages/tweepy/models.py", line 146, in followers
    return self._api.followers(user_id=self.id, **kargs)
  File "/usr/local/lib/python2.7/dist-packages/tweepy/binder.py", line 197, in _call
    return method.execute()
  File "/usr/local/lib/python2.7/dist-packages/tweepy/binder.py", line 173, in execute
    raise TweepError(error_msg, resp)
tweepy.error.TweepError: Not authorized.

私はウェブアプリを構築していません。したがって、認証はより簡単です。

consumer_key="----------"
consumer_secret="----------"
access_token="--------------"
access_token_secret="-----------------"

auth = tweepy.OAuthHandler(consumer_key, consumer_secret)
auth.set_access_token(access_token, access_token_secret)

api = tweepy.API(auth)

api.get_user('---').followers()
4

2 に答える 2

18

修理済み。特定のユーザーがツイートを保護していました。したがって、 .followers() は失敗していました。

于 2013-10-23T22:04:36.187 に答える